What is a foundry engineer?

A foundry is a factory or other facility that creates metal castings of products. A foundry engineer designs or upgrades these facilities. They determine the size and strength of the building required based on the client’s needs, ensuring the facility can withstand the high levels of heat needed to make metal molds, utilizes top-of-the-line technologies, and that its construction provides maximum efficiency. Foundry engineers may also redesign or make improvements to older factories to make them more productive. To pursue a career in foundry engineering, you need at least a bachelor’s degree in engineering or a related field. Other qualifications may include experience with metalworks or in the construction industry.

What are some common challenges foundry engineers face when working with new alloys or casting techniques?

Foundry Engineers often encounter challenges such as unpredictable material behavior, difficulty in achieving desired mechanical properties, and managing defects like porosity or cracking when working with new alloys or casting processes. Addressing these requires close collaboration with metallurgists, quality assurance teams, and production staff to fine-tune process parameters and conduct thorough testing. Staying updated on industry advancements and utilizing simulation software can also help mitigate these challenges and ensure optimal casting outcomes.

What is the difference between Foundry Engineer vs Metallurgist?

AspectFoundry EngineerMetallurgist
CredentialsBachelor's in Mechanical, Materials, or Metallurgical EngineeringBachelor's or Master's in Metallurgy, Materials Science, or related fields
Work EnvironmentManufacturing plants, foundries, casting facilitiesResearch labs, metallurgical labs, industrial settings
Industry UsageDesigning and improving casting processes, overseeing productionAnalyzing metal properties, developing alloys, quality control

Foundry Engineers focus on designing, managing, and optimizing casting processes in manufacturing environments. Metallurgists analyze metal properties and develop new alloys. While both roles require knowledge of metals, Foundry Engineers are more involved in production processes, whereas Metallurgists focus on material analysis and research.

Booz Allen Hamilton is a leading provider of management and technology consulting services to the US government in defense, intelligence, and civil markets. Headquartered in McLean, Virginia, the firm also serves major corporations, institutions, and not-for-profit organizations. Founded in 1914 by Edwin G. Booz, the company has a long-standing tradition of helping clients achieve success by delivering a wide range of consulting services that include strategic planning, human capital and learning, communication, systems development, and others. The company's mission is to empower people to change the world, and it has a reputation for maintaining the highest standards of integrity and-excellence.
